On Jan. 6 the board approved a batch of resolutions (26-0043 through 26-0058) authorizing agreements with multiple substitute care providers to serve individuals referred by the Montgomery County Department of Job and Family Services (MCDJFS) through Dec. 31, 2027. Providers named on the agenda include Adriel School, A Loving Heart Youth Services, Angels Guarding Youth Services, Buckeye Ranch, Caring for Kids, Haven’s Nest, Lighthouse Youth Services, Marie's House of Hope, the Bair Foundation and others.
These agreements were placed on the consent docket and carried as presented; the meeting record lists provider names and the general purpose (substitute care services) but does not state individual contract amounts or service capacity in the agenda lines. County staff will finalize agreements according to department procurement procedures and program eligibility rules.
